    Hi All, 
    
    I am looking to find a "freeware" MS Access password cracker. 
    
    I have searched the Internet for over two days only to find multiple
    commercial 
    packages, which claim to guess the first two or three letters. With all the 
    commercial products I have had different results for the first three
    letters, 
    therefore cannot be sure of their effectiveness. 
    
    Any helo what-so-ever is very much appreciated.
